Why Serviced Apartments Are Gaining Traction

1. Economic Growth and Business Travel

East African economies, particularly Kenya, Uganda, Tanzania, and Rwanda, have shown robust growth over the past decade. According to the World Bank, increased foreign investment and infrastructural development have boosted business activities. This surge has led to a higher demand for flexible, comfortable accommodations for professionals on short to medium-term assignments.

2. Tourism Expansion

The region's rich cultural heritage, wildlife, and natural beauty attract millions of tourists annually. Serviced apartments offer an attractive alternative to traditional hotels, providing more space, privacy, and the ability to self-cater, which enhances the travel experience.

3. Urbanization and Expatriate Communities

Rapid urbanization has led to the growth of cities like Nairobi, Kampala, and Dar es Salaam. Expatriates and relocating professionals seek accommodations that combine comfort with convenience, making serviced apartments an ideal choice.

4. Cost-Effectiveness

For extended stays, serviced apartments are often more cost-effective than hotels. They offer competitive rates without compromising on amenities, making them appealing for both individuals and companies managing travel budgets.

Benefits of Serviced Apartments

1. Home-Like Comfort

Serviced apartments come fully furnished with living areas, kitchens, and bedrooms, providing a homely environment. This setup is particularly beneficial for families and long-term guests who prefer the flexibility of cooking and more living space.

2. Amenities and Services

Guests enjoy hotel-like services such as housekeeping, security, and sometimes gym and pool access. These amenities enhance the stay experience without the impersonal feel of a hotel.

3. Privacy and Flexibility

With separate living spaces and private entrances, guests have more privacy. Flexible lease terms cater to various needs, from daily rentals to monthly stays.

Key Markets in East Africa

Nairobi, Kenya

Nairobi is a leading hub for multinational corporations and NGOs. Areas like Westlands and Kilimani have seen a proliferation of serviced apartments catering to professionals and tourists.

Kampala, Uganda

Kampala's growing economy and expatriate population have increased demand for serviced accommodations, especially in neighborhoods like Kololo and Naguru.

Dar es Salaam, Tanzania

As a major port city, Dar es Salaam attracts business travelers. Serviced apartments in areas like Masaki and Oyster Bay offer luxury accommodations with ocean views.

Challenges and Considerations

Market Saturation

The rapid growth of serviced apartments may lead to oversupply in some areas, potentially affecting occupancy rates and returns on investment.

Regulatory Environment

Varying regulations across countries can impact operations. Investors and operators must navigate licensing, taxation, and compliance requirements.

Competition with Traditional Hotels

Hotels are adapting by offering extended stay options and competitive pricing, intensifying competition in the accommodation sector.

FAQs

What is the difference between a serviced apartment and a hotel room?

A serviced apartment offers a full apartment setup with separate living areas, kitchens, and bedrooms, providing a home-like environment. Hotels typically offer single rooms with limited space and facilities for self-catering.

Are serviced apartments more expensive than traditional rentals?

While the nightly rate may be higher than traditional long-term rentals, serviced apartments often include utilities, amenities, and services, offering better value for short to medium-term stays.
